Output ec274b6845d56f9a793deeba75f9188656dd73f78c002284e2bf401c0d83519e:1

value
15923955
script pubkey
OP_0 OP_PUSHBYTES_32 18ac3e7a9830649bd85b7e0a0f8a5ed26a4c5911e21fc00aa8c649bbc2e4afae
address
bc1qrzkru75cxpjfhkzm0c9qlzj76f4yckg3ug0uqz4gceymhshy47hqyn6vm2
transaction
ec274b6845d56f9a793deeba75f9188656dd73f78c002284e2bf401c0d83519e
spent
true